Consider a comparatively new norm: using a smartphone in social settings. In a modern study, nearly 90% of U.S. Grown ups admitted to using their phone during their most up-to-date social conversation. You'll be able to see this behavior at nearly any restaurant, marriage reception, or fraternity party. Whilst it is now a norm, research finds that phone use can diminish our satisfaction of social interactions and undermine our perception of connection to good friends and family. When it involves thinking about the social world, Now we have a number of common biases and blind spots that prevent us from looking at things clearly. For example, Many of us think we’re much better than typical inside of a number of domains (like driving ability), but we’re overly pessimistic about our social life. We inaccurately Consider that other people show up at more parties, have more friends, and revel in a bigger social circle than we do ourselves. It’s a distorted perception that can cause emotions of disconnection and dissatisfaction. We also see the social world through the filter of our earlier experiences.
